Top Threat Intelligence Tools for Proactive Cybersecurity

Staying ahead of emerging cyber dangers requires a reliable threat intelligence system. Several powerful tools are present to assist IT professionals in gaining a competitive advantage. These systems can provide crucial insights into cybercriminal tactics, methods, and workflows. Consider examining options like Recorded Future, which collects information from diverse channels; CrowdStrike Falcon Intelligence, known for its risk investigation capabilities; Anomali ThreatStream, which centralizes threat data; and Mandiant Advantage, celebrated for its expertise in incident response. Furthermore, open-source choices, such as MISP (Malware Information Sharing Platform), can support group threat exchange. The Evolution of Threat Intelligence Platforms: Trends to 2026

The landscape of threat intelligence platforms is undergoing a dramatic evolution, driven by increasingly complex cyberattacks and the rising quantity of available data. Looking ahead to 2026, several key directions are set to reshape how organizations detect and handle threats. We anticipate a move towards more self-sufficient platforms, leveraging deep learning to process threat data and order alerts with greater accuracy . The convergence of threat intelligence with Security Orchestration, Automation and Response (SOAR) systems will become standard , enabling quicker action. Ransomware Intelligence Furthermore, expect to see a growing focus on contextual threat intelligence, moving beyond simple Indicators of Compromise (IOCs) to incorporate contextual information and actionable insights. Finally, the rise of distributed threat intelligence sharing – where organizations collaborate data – will be vital for combating advanced persistent adversaries.
